Essentially, web-hosted software means you use applications over the internet instead of putting them directly on your device . Think of it like streaming a film on copyright - the data isn't stored on your machine, but you're using it. This method offers advantages such as increased accessibility from anywhere place and often smaller upfront fees. You generally pay for a platform rather than purchasing the application itself.

Cloud Software Security: What You Need to Know
As more businesses transfer their platforms to the online environment , understanding cloud-based security becomes absolutely critical . This involves more than just protecting data ; it requires a holistic approach that addresses the shared read more responsibility model among the vendor and the client . Key considerations include identity and access management , data protection, and vulnerability scans to detect and lessen vulnerabilities. Failing to do so can result in significant financial losses and serious legal repercussions .
Future Trends in Cloud-Based Software Development
The landscape of cloud-based software development is poised for significant transformation , driven by emerging technologies and shifting needs . We're observing a rise in serverless architectures , allowing for greater speed and cost savings. Furthermore, low-code/no-code platforms will continue to enable citizen developers and accelerate application delivery . Artificial automation will play a crucial function in automating testing, improving performance, and providing proactive insights. Finally, a focus on distributed computing and the merging of cloud services with IoT technologies will shape the future trajectory of development.
Moving to Online Applications: A Phased Approach
Embarking on a cloud move of your software can feel complex, but a organized step-by-step method minimizes risk and promotes a triumphant result. To begin, perform a thorough assessment of your current infrastructure. Then, design a precise migration plan, including specific schedules and budgetary factors. After that, prioritize programs for transfer, beginning with minor components. Throughout the process, maintain open communication with all personnel. In conclusion, thoroughly validate all migrated software before retiring the older infrastructure.
